配置热部署
https://blog.csdn.net/m0_37708405/article/details/80867131针对Java web 项目idea的热部署
https://baijiahao.baidu.com/s?id=1584998695558620414&wfr=spider&for=pc&tdsourcetag=s_pcqq_aiomsg&qq-pf-to=pcqq.c2c
第四步:
-Dfile.encoding=UTF-8
https://blog.csdn.net/weixin_39208819/article/details/82320818
https://blog.csdn.net/shubingzhuoxue/article/details/81302797
IDEA乱码问题
控制台乱码问题:
https://blog.csdn.net/alvin_1992/article/details/79892919?tdsourcetag=s_pcqq_aiomsg
第一步:修改intellij idea配置文件:
找到intellij idea安装目录,bin文件夹下面idea64.exe.vmoptions和idea.exe.vmoptions这两个文件,分别在这两个文件中添加:-Dfile.encoding=UTF-8
第二步:找到intellij idea的file---settings---Editor---FileEncodings的GlobalEncoding和ProjectEncoding和Default encoding for properties都配置成UTF-8
file->setting->Editor->File Encoding
Global Encoding:utf-8
Project Encoding:GBK 与 reader.getEncoding()保持一致,读取文件格式要用GBK,才能读到中文
Defalt encoding for properties files:GBK 控制台中文
第三步:在部署Tomcat的VM options项中添加:-Dfile.encoding=UTF-8
第四步:重启Intellij idea即可解决乱码问题(一定要关闭idea重新打开)
Idea配置Maven需要注意的
一、jdk设1.8以上
二、在 E:\Apache\apache-maven-3.5.4\conf\setting.xml文件中配置镜像
三、改setting默认位置为下载目录的setting,不要使用c:/user下的setting
四、idea内配置maven
五、idea使用MAVEN没有匹配到的包
https://www.cnblogs.com/bwlang/p/8038080.html
用 spring boot 构建项目,在pom中引入sqlserver 驱动包的时候,启动程序报错,网上搜了一下,发现maven中不支持jdbc4 一下的类库。本地maven 安装jdbc,搞定!
http://search.maven.org/中没有sqlserver的jdbc驱动,所以需要本地安装sqljdbc的jar包,然后再在pom里面引入
Step 1
在微软官网下载sqljdbc的jar包:http://www.microsoft.com/en-us/download/details.aspx?displaylang=en&id=11774
本次下载了4.2版本 ,可以支持jre8
Step 2
通过maven命令将jar包安装到本地。
在有sqljdbc4.jar包的文件夹下,通过shift+右键的方式--》此处打开命令窗口,然后执行以下maven命令
mvn install:install-file -Dfile=sqljdbc42.jar -Dpackaging=jar -DgroupId=com.microsoft.sqlserver -DartifactId=sqljdbc4 -Dversion=4.2
命令解释:mvn install:install-file -Dfile="jar包的绝对路径" -Dpackaging="文件打包方式" -DgroupId=groupid名 -DartifactId=artifactId名 -Dversion=jar版本
Step 3
在pom.xml中引入本地jar包
com.microsoft.sqlserver
sqljdbc4
4.2
六、创建maven+spring MVC项目
https://www.cnblogs.com/shang-shang/p/7477607.html
七、idea编译xml、properties文件规则
如果是这样配的:
编译出来的文件路径就在根目录
如果是这样配的:
编译出来的文件路径就在wan/mapper文件夹中
如果是这样配的:
编译出来的文件路径就在com.mapper文件夹中